#dd96c1 color RGB value is (221,150,193). #dd96c1 color name is Custom Color color.
#dd96c1 hex color red value is 221, green value is 150 and the blue value of its RGB is 193.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#dd96c1 hue: 0.90, saturation: 0.51 and the lightness value of dd96c1 is 0.73.
The process color (four color CMYK) of #dd96c1 color hex is 0.00, 0.32, 0.13, 0.13. Web safe color of #dd96c1 is #cc99cc. Color #dd96c1 contains mainly PINK color.

About #DD96C1 Custom Color
#DD96C1 (Custom Color) is a pink-based color with RGB values of 221, 150, 193. This color belongs to the pink color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.
When working with #dd96c1,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.
For web development, #dd96c1 can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#dd96c1), RGB (rgb(221, 150, 193)), HSL (hsl(324, 51%, 73%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#cc99cc,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
